Hi all, In my former unified communications platform, I could register 3 or 4 differents phones numbers like my home phone numbers, office number and mobile number, and create the rules for forwarding the calls.
This was very helpfull to initiate the calls from the web interface and have it connected to one of the phone numbers I had registered.
Then the platform would call me in the phone I had for that time being, and only after I answer, the call would complete to the other party. I have not been able to find the same function here. Could anyone clarify for me how that would be possible? Or the 3cx does not support this?
 
There are a few options, but, not as extensive as I think you want it to work. You want a "find me" service that keeps trying multiple numbers until there is an answer (by a person). You can have 3CX ring a number (Ring my Mobile at the same time) as ringing an extension. You can forward to a single number based on caller ID or time of day (Office hours). You can ring numbers in sequence (or all at once in a group) by using a Ring Group options, but then you'd have to forward those calls off to outside numbers from each extension. You could also use the call rebound feature.

One big fly in the ointment, (in most cases) is that a call directed to a number that is then answered by voicemail (mobile provider), will end the call.
